"hey guys, i have a 97 a4 1.8Tq, and i've been wanting to change the center console's lighting, right now, the lights are red, and i've been thinkin of changing the lights to a blue color, anyone know what size bulbs u need and a vague procedure on taking off the face of the center console? i know that this will be a pain to do, but im up for the challenge."


mostly just askin for the size of the bulbs, and how to remove the center console to get at the led's, thanks

Default Not to sound negative, but I can almost guarantee you won't find the info you seek...

the reason being... the backlighting on the center counsel and dash is not created by separate bulbs that can just be un-plugged and simply replaced. The LED's are permanently soldered into the switches and therefore not considered replaceable. Sure, you can buy a replacement switch, but you can't buy the individual components that make up the switch.

If you want to replace the lights, first you'll have to gut all the switches (if that's even possible without destroying them), and if you get that far, you'll need to de-solder the LED's and figure out what size they are. Then you'll need to determine the parameters of the LED's... which usually isn't something that is printed on the bulb... such as the brightness factor, the resistance, and the current rating. Once you get all that info, you'd need to find an electronics supplier that sells blue LED's with the same specs.

I could be wrong, but I'm HIGHLY doubtful the Bentley manual will have that info because if a backlit switch burned out, it wouldn't instruct you to replace the LED... it would tell you to just replace the entire switch. And considering nobody here has ever done it that we know of, you're probably on your own.

Good luck if you decide to try. Your best bet might be to try and find an online junk parts distributor like Dad's Auto, and see if you can buy the center counsel switches, HVAC controls, stock radio, and HVAC display from them cheap... that way you can experiment on those parts to see if they can be disassembled. Some of those parts might be sonically welded which means there are no re-useable fasteners holding them together. You might have to break them apart in order to open them up. Obviously that's not a good thing.
